Decision made: Quillbase moves all new contracts to annual billing from the start of next fiscal year. Monthly option survives only for accounts under the Thornley threshold. Existing customers convert at renewal — no forced mid-term switches. Discount for annual prepay: 8%, non-negotiable without regional approval. Update quote templates now; old terms invalid after cutover. Objection-handling scripts are on the Larkspur page. Commission treatment unchanged. Sales leads should read the confidential planning note below before briefing teams.

internal memo for kawip-hadug: Headcount on the Wenwyn team goes from 7 to 140 by the end of January. Gross margin on Wenwyn came in at 20 percent against a plan of 15 percent.

## Quillfeed Environments

Welcome aboard! Quillfeed is our markdown rendering pipeline, and it runs in three environments: sandbox, staging, and prod. Sandbox is where you can break things freely — it re-renders every doc on push, so it's slow but honest. Staging mirrors prod's renderer version and plugin set, which matters because markdown extensions behave differently across versions. Prod renders are cached aggressively, so don't panic if your change takes a few minutes to show. Here are the current staging configuration values.

deployment values, kajep-kageg:
[praix]
host = praix.paliqcorp.corp
user = praix_svc
database = praix_prod

Runbook: migrating plugin builds to the Hallowfen hermetic toolchain. Plugin authors must drop all network fetches from build scripts; declare inputs in the manifest instead. Vendored blobs go under the sealed-assets directory and must be checksummed. Run the Veridane sandbox check locally before submitting — unsealed reads fail the gate. Legacy Makefile targets are ignored after the cutover. Submit via the Thornquist portal only. Your sandbox run will emit the token shown below.

session token of bawep-yadup = htk21_528abd376e3c5a4ec24a1